Check out myprivacypolicy.com: My Privacy Policy is a service that sits on your desktop that allows you to automatically create and use a virtual email address whenever you want to protect your real email address. You can specify how long your virtual email address is active and who can use it to contact you. You can specify what happens to any email that’s in violation of your rules, for example, whether to block it, or receive it with a warning. So, if any one of your virtual addresses is obtained by spammers or someone else who isn’t permitted access, all incoming email is blocked at our server, before it ever gets to you. >From the FAQ: How else is MPP protected?
